Shillong, Sept. 12 -- The Meghalaya government on Friday said that there is no proposal for the privatisation of the Mawmluh Cherra Cements Limited (MCCL), one of the state's oldest public sector undertaking unit.

Replying to queries raised during the Question Hour in the assembly, Deputy Chief Minister in-charge Industries department, Sniawbhalang Dhar said the earlier proposal for a Joint Venture partnership with MCCL did not materialise as a suitable partner was not found at that time.
